    Hello Smurfy I would just keep the support there untill it can support itself

    Tell you what I would do ............... just tie it to the support a little higher up but be very carefull how you do it, is that a one of those ties that have wire in them because I have snapped a the odd stem when I tried to use them (tightend it up a bit too much ) . So I just use some fine string to fasten the plant to the stick
    Oh and leave it so the knot can give way as the plant grows, again I once put in a knot that didn't give way and almost strangled the plant
